Pregunta

Estoy tratando de instalar SciPy siguiendo estas instrucciones: http://www.scipy.org/Download

Y recibiendo constantemente de error para construirlas para OS X 10.5.7 Lepeord:

dyld: Símbolo perezoso no Encuadernación: Símbolo no encontrado: _iconv_open   Referenciado a partir de: /usr/lib/libaprutil-1.0.dylib   Esperado en: /opt/local/lib/libiconv.2.dylib

dyld: Símbolo no encontrado: _iconv_open   Referenciado a partir de: /usr/lib/libaprutil-1.0.dylib   Esperado en: /opt/local/lib/libiconv.2.dylib

Rastreo (llamada más reciente pasado):   Archivo "setup.py", línea 82, en     FullVersion + = svn_version ()   Archivo "setup.py", la línea 74, en svn_version     aumentar ValueError ( "Error al analizar la versión SVN?") ValueError:? Un error al analizar la versión SVN

¿Fue útil?

Solución

¿Es absolutamente necesario para que usted construya SciPy de la fuente? Parece que sería mucho más fácil de instalar SciPy en Leopard Mac OS X utilizando el SciPy Superpack instalador (que se menciona en el SciPy descarga la página ). Así es como yo instalado SciPy, y nunca he tenido ningún problema con él.

Otros consejos

La razón por la que está fallando es que usted tiene que se han instalado en / opt / local, que están interfiriendo con las bibliotecas del sistema. libiconv está instalado en / usr / lib

DarwinPorts tiene la costumbre de echar a perder las cosas. Desarmar el DYLD_LIBRARY_PATH cuando se ejecuta (y cuando se utiliza) bibliotecas como éste iban a arreglarlo.

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ow
scroll top